C.A. 2nd;
B275255

The Second Appellate District dismissed an appeal and granted in part a petition for writ of mandate. The court held that the death knell exception to the one final judgment rule does not apply to the dismiss of class claims when a representative claim under the Labor Code Private Attorneys General Act of 2004 (PAGA) remains pending.
